Abstract
The invention provides a kind of Fructus Mali pumilae water-fertilizer integral fertilizing method, fertilizer is dissolved in irrigation water, use the mode infiltrating irrigation of infiltrating irrigation in root region soil, specifically include and apple plants is carried out following cyclical process: after picking fruit, infiltrating irrigation is fertile, budding period infiltrating irrigation is fertile, young fruit period infiltrating irrigation fertilizer, fruit expanding period infiltrating irrigation fertilizer, flower bud differentiation period infiltrating irrigation fruit colour-change period infiltrating irrigation fertile, swollen fertilizer.Compared with conventional fertilizer application method, save fertilizer amount more than 50%;And the filtration irrigation method used by the present invention keeps earth's surface micro-wet, significantly reduces water evaporation quantity, 0.07 hectare only with 23 tons of water, compares 15 tons of every mu of water ground of traditional drip irrigation or broad irrigation, this method water saving 80%;And instant invention overcomes the differential pressure problem that the gradient causes, go up a slope lower liquid manure uniform flow on slope, and under going up a slope in slope, tree body growing way is the same, significantly improves yield more than 30%;Pipe for osmotic irrigation used by the present invention is embedded in underground, does not affect field weeding and the farming operation sprayed insecticide.

Background technology
Apple tree is happiness light fruit tree, and the length at sunshine, the strong and weak coloring on Apple and quality have directly impact.
Impinge upon bud differentiation and the growth of fruit being conducive to Fructus Mali pumilae between 2200~2700 hours year day.Day and night temperature is big, illumination is filled
Foot is conducive to the sugared part accumulation in fruit, the content improving vitamin and the coloring of Apple.
Fructus Mali pumilae is seeds relatively cold-resistant in deciduous fruit tree, is mainly distributed on the wide geographic area of North of Yangtze River in China.The suitableeest
Suitable growing temperatures is annual 9~14 DEG C, the coldest month mean temperature-10~10 DEG C between, grow in 4~October
Period is advisable in the range of requiring mean temperature 10~20 DEG C, can cultivate between mean temperature 6~17 DEG C.
The edaphic condition that Fructus Mali pumilae requires is that physical features is smooth, soil layer is deep, draining is good, the content of organic matter is up to 2~3%.
The root system of Fructus Mali pumilae is more flourishing, and root system focuses mostly on below 20 centimetres, the moisture in absorbable deep soil and nutrient, needs note
Meaning deep soil improvement with foster and apply fertilizer.Plantation Fructus Mali pumilae Production Zones Suitable annual precipitation to reach 500~800 millimeters, less than 400 millis
Rice, dry regional culture Fructus Mali pumilae must be irrigated.
Traditional fertilization for apple method is as follows: trees in richful production period (more than life in 8 years) every mu of i.e. fertilizer 3500 of basal dressing~
4000kg/ mu, general calcium 62kg/ mu, carbamide 9kg/ mu, potassium sulfate 12kg/ mu;Late May to early June stops growing at the spring tip
Shi Shiliang imposes ammonium fertilizer, contributes to the Physiological Differentiation of bud, joins simultaneously and execute a certain amount of phosphorus, potash fertilizer;The most once topdress
In mid or late August, when autumn growth stops growing, on the basis of using phosphorus potash fertilizer in a large number, appropriateness supplements nitrogenous fertilizer.The method fertilising has
Unreasonable part, reason is as follows:
Fructus Mali pumilae different in growth characteristic in each of growth in period, and fertilizer requirement is the most different.Fructus Mali pumilae is from germinateing to fruit maturation altogether
Experience initial bloom stage, flower bud differentiation period, several period such as Xie Huahou to young fruit period, fruit expanding period etc., all ages and classes period, fertilizer is needed to plant
Class and dose also differ.In the best fruiting period, because of its large result, phosphorus, potash fertilizer demand are increased, at the base ensureing nitrogen fertilizer amount
On plinth, phosphorus to be increased, the amount of application of potash fertilizer, applying of potash fertilizer to be paid attention to, to improve fruit quality.
Recommended rate of fertilizer application is often to produce 1000kg/ mu Fructus Mali pumilae, executes nitrogen (N) 7kg/ mu, phosphorus (P2O5) 3.5kg/ mu, potassium (K2O)
7kg/ mu.Base manure optimal application period is mid-September-late October, and late variety applies after requiring to gather as early as possible.Fruit
Phase and period of maturation Amount of potassium absorbed are more than nitrogen, but on the occasion of rainy season, nitrogen is easy to run off, Fructus Mali pumilae stable high yield it is crucial that this phase stably supply
Nitrogen nutrition.
Fructus Mali pumilae has several vital critical period of nutrition in whole growth course, during these, has both needed fertilizer
Material supplement various nutrient need again abundance moisture, make nutrient can be fully absorbed by root system and then accelerate blade and
Stem stalk, the fruit utilization rate to fertilizer, improves tree body resistance, reduces sickness rate.So, this invention makes the rich water of Fructus Mali pumilae demand
Supplementing, nutrient formula is reasonable, and time of application meets the regulation of fertilizer requirement of Fructus Mali pumilae simultaneously.
Need fertilizer according to apple tree needs water feature, 6 fertilisings of employing general to bearing-age tree.

Preferably, the number of times of described budding period infiltrating irrigation fertilizer is 1 time, includes by fertile kind and consumption thereof: high nitrogen height phosphate fertilizer
(19-45-6) 10-50kg/ mu, bacterium solution (living bacteria count >=3.0 hundred million/mL) 10-50L/ mu;Wherein, described high nitrogen height phosphate fertilizer
(19-45-6) refer specifically to nitrogen element content be 19%, phosphorus element content be 45%, Determination of Potassium be the fertilizer of 6%;Described bacterium
Viable count >=3.0 hundred million/ml in liquid;Described bacterium solution refers specifically to crop probiotic bacteria, including bacillus subtilis, Bacillus licheniformis,
The mixed bacteria liquid concentration of the two is 3.0 hundred million/ml;Described bacterium solution refers specifically to probiotic bacteria sending out under conventional culture conditions and culture medium
Ferment stock solution.
It is further preferred that also need to carry out foliage dressing while described budding period infiltrating irrigation fertilizer;Described foliage dressing
Kind and consumption are boron fertilizer 200-600mL/ mu;Described boron fertilizer refers specifically to the fertilizer of boron content >=130g/L.Spray blade face,
Preferable infiltrating irrigation fertilizer efficiency fruit can be reached.
Budding period typically flows to before early April blooms at early March resin, and the budding period is the apple tree anniversary to need water to need fertilizer
First critical period, be now to promote that rudiment is neat by fertile main purpose, improve and sit Fructus Mali pumilae rate and promote Spring-shoot growth, nutrition
Grow vigorous, need nitrogenous fertilizer many, be aided with appropriate phosphate fertilizer.High nitrogen height phosphate fertilizer promotes the growth of root system, stem and leaf, and it is organic that bacterium solution supplements soil
Matter, increases soil microbe quantity, makes loosing soil breathe freely, beneficially root growth.Boron fertilizer promote Fructus Mali pumilae bloom, prevent flower and not
Real.
Preferably, the number of times of described young fruit period infiltrating irrigation fertilizer is 1 time, includes by fertile kind and consumption thereof: ca and mg fertilizer (13-
0-0-17-6) 10-40kg/ mu, organic carbon fertile (organic matter >=50%) 20-60kg/ mu, bacterium solution 10-50L/ mu;In described bacterium solution
Viable count >=3.0 hundred million/ml;Wherein, described high calcium high fertiliser containing magnesium (13-0-0-17-6) refers specifically to calcic amount of element 17%, containing magnesium unit
Element amount 6%, the fertilizer of Nitrogen element 13%;Described bacterium solution refers specifically to crop probiotic bacteria, including bacillus subtilis, lichens spore
Bacillus, the mixed bacteria liquid concentration of the two is 3.0 hundred million/ml;Described bacterium solution refers specifically to probiotic bacteria in conventional culture conditions and culture medium
Under fermenation raw liquid.
It is further preferred that also need to carry out foliage dressing while described young fruit period infiltrating irrigation fertilizer;Described foliage dressing
Kind and consumption include: zinc fertilizer 200-600mL/ mu;Wherein, described zinc fertilizer refers specifically to the fertilizer of weight content >=15% of zinc element
Material.
Young fruit period is for by the end of May at the beginning of 6 months, and this time fertilising can be effectively facilitated to be bloomed and prevent in time because consumption of blooming is a large amount of
Nutrient and produce de-fertilizer, improve fruit-setting rate, promote New shoot growth.This phase is that apple tree needs nutrition most period, except children
Outside fruit quickly forms, grows, with at a time when young sprout vigorous growth, both easily produce contradiction in nutrient distribution, vie each other.
Therefore, quite raw important topdressing of this period, size, yield and quality to fruit, young sprout is mushroomed out and leaf
Having quickly formed of curtain directly acts on.Ca and mg fertilizer can promote fruit growth, replenish the calcium, and organic carbon is fertile and bacterium solution is supplemented soil and had
Machine matter, increases micro organism quantity, and zinc fertilizer promotes leaf growth, prevents and treats little leaf.
Preferably, the number of times of described fruit expanding period infiltrating irrigation fertilizer is 1 time, includes by fertile kind and consumption thereof: ca and mg fertilizer
(13-0-0-17-6) 10-40kg/ mu, organic carbon fertilizer 20-60kg/ mu;Wherein, described ca and mg fertilizer (13-0-0-17-6) refers specifically to
Calcic amount of element 17%, containing magnesium elements amount 6%, the fertilizer of Nitrogen element 13%;Described organic carbon fertilizer refers specifically to organic weight
The fertilizer of content >=50%.
It is further preferred that also need foliage dressing while described fruit expanding period infiltrating irrigation fertilizer;Described foliage dressing
Kind and consumption thereof include: calcareous fertilisers 200-600mL/ mu;Described calcareous fertilisers specifically refer to the fertilizer of calcium constituent weight content >=180g/L
Material.Mid or late June is young fruit expanding stage.
Fructus Mali pumilae for the first time summit of growth thank spend after before and after 1 month, spring slightly summit of growth just, up to 1 month, this phase master
If wanting apple cells to be split into master.Fructus Mali pumilae Fuji kind is contained and is spent latter 25 days, is that fruit cell separates the Sheng phase, catches this period
Meet its supply to liquid manure, to improving " Fuji " fruit cell division coefficient, increase fruit weight, have the work got twice the result with half the effort
With.
Preferably, the number of times of described flower bud differentiation period infiltrating irrigation fertilizer is 1 time, includes by fertile kind and consumption thereof: high nitrogen
High phosphate fertilizer (19-45-6) 10-50kg/ mu, bacterium solution 10-50L/ mu;Wherein, described high nitrogen height phosphate fertilizer (19-45-6) refers specifically to nitrogen
Constituent content is 19%, phosphorus element content is 45%, Determination of Potassium is the fertilizer of 6%;Viable count >=3.0 in described bacterium solution
Hundred million/ml;Described bacterium solution refers specifically to crop probiotic bacteria, and including bacillus subtilis, Bacillus licheniformis, the mixed bacteria liquid of the two is dense
Degree is 3.0 hundred million/ml;Described bacterium solution refers specifically to probiotic bacteria fermenation raw liquid under conventional culture conditions and culture medium.Mid or late July
At flower bud differentiation period, this time is the critical period of bud differentiation, determines the quantity of the fruit tire in the coming year.Now bud differentiation needs
Wanting more phosphorus element, phosphorus element promotes bud differentiation, makes spring tip tissue enrich, and bud satiation improves flower quality in the coming year, and raising is awarded
Powder rate, promotes to bear fruit, and can effectively control biennial bearing.
Preferably, the number of times of described swollen fruit colour-change period infiltrating irrigation fertilizer is 1 time, includes by fertile kind and consumption thereof: high potassium
Fertile (12-6-40) 10-40kg/ mu, organic carbon fertilizer 20-60kg/ mu;Wherein, described high potash fertilizer (12-6-40) refers specifically to nitrogen element
Content 12%, phosphorus element content 6%, the fertilizer of Determination of Potassium 40%;Described organic carbon fertilizer refers specifically to organic weight content
The fertilizer of >=50%.
It is further preferred that also need to carry out foliage dressing while described swollen fruit colour-change period infiltrating irrigation fertilizer;Described blade face is executed
Fertile kind and consumption thereof include: calcareous fertilisers 200-600mL/ mu;Wherein, described calcareous fertilisers refer specifically to calcium element content >=180g/L's
Agricultural Fertilizer.August is Fructus Mali pumilae swollen fruit colour-change period, and be mainly apple cells volume during this increases to master.Now Fructus Mali pumilae is
It is changed into the sugar trophophase by the nitrogen nutrition phase.Inorganic nutrients are needed feature to be to potassium, calcium, magnesium and relevant certain by Fructus Mali pumilae during this period
The demand of secondary element slightly is relatively big, and demand intensity is the highest.Wherein potassium element is to increasing the accumulation of carbohydrate and in fruit
Transport, promote the expanding of fruit, strengthens coloring, the effect of raising yield is particular importance.The calcium element fruit to improving fruit
Glue content preventing and treating bitter pit, improve fruit quality and storage property energy it is critical that, fruit tree must also be had more sufficient simultaneously
Magnesium element supply, to promote chlorophyllous formation.

Comparative example 1
Comparative example 1 is the comparative example of embodiment 1, is only that in place of contrast: comparative example 1 was not carried out in Fructus Mali pumilae swollen fruit colour-change period
Infiltrating irrigation is fertile.
Comparative example 2
This comparative example is the comparative example of embodiment 1, is only that our team's ratio uses conventional fertilizer application method, fruit picking in place of contrast
Every mu of organic fertilizer 3500-4000kg/ mu afterwards, general calcium 62kg/ mu, carbamide 9kg/ mu, potassium sulfate 12kg/ mu;Late May is to 6
The first tenday period of a month moon impose ammonium hydrogen carbonate 20kg, potassium dihydrogen phosphate 15kg, calcium superphosphate 40kg in the spring when tip stops growing;Under in 8 months
Ten days, calcium superphosphate 65kg, carbamide 20kg.
Statistical data is as shown in the table:
Table 1
Percentage of fertile fruit | Pour water utilization rate | Irrigation uniformity | 80mm and above fruit | Bitter pit disease rate | |
Comparative example 1 | 82% | 91% | 90% | 72% | < 10% |
Comparative example 2 | 70% | 49% | 41% | 53% | < 20% |
Embodiment 1 | 85% | 93% | 92% | 81% | < 4% |
Using method of the present invention, water-saving result is notable, and the utilization rate of infiltrating irrigation water reaches 93%, irrigation uniformity
Reach 92%, than traditional drip irrigation and broad irrigation water saving more than 50%.The method using the present invention, tree vigo(u)r is vigorous, setting of blooming
Rate is up to 85%, and more than 80mm fruit accounting is 81%, is greatly improved fruit and is worth, and bitter pit sickness rate reaches less than 4%, disease
Rate is significantly reduced, and effectively reduces apple disease and occurs.
